Bauer throws support to Barrett
Lt. Gov. Andre Bauer has endorsed U.S. Rep. Gresham Barrett in the Republican gubernatorial runoff on June 22.

Barrett is facing Lexington state Rep. Nikki Haley.

In a statement, Bauer said Barrett was the only candidate he could trust.

“I hope the media and the voters take these next two weeks to really look at the candidates: their real records – not just their rhetoric,” Bauer said. “When they do they will find Gresham Barrett has been a committed conservative soldier in the movement against big government long before it was politically advantageous.
